Sr Machine Learning Engineer, Adobe Firefly Services
Listed on 2026-05-14
-
Software Development
Software Engineer, AI Engineer
Adobe Firefly’s Generative AI Services team is seeking Senior Machine Learning Engineers for our GenAI Services area. In this high‑impact role, you will work with a team of talented engineers in building scalable, high‑performance generative AI systems—powering features across Adobe products like Firefly, Photoshop, Illustrator, Express, Stock, and Premiere.
You will design and develop efficient inference pipelines, optimize models for latency and throughput at inference, and build APIs and ecosystems that integrate both Adobe’s first‑party and third‑party generative models into Adobe’s suite of products that serve individual and enterprise customers. You will tackle Adobe’s most complex engineering challenges at the forefront of the industry, set technical direction, and mentor other ML engineers.
Responsibilities- Design and develop core GenAI services and APIs that integrate a wide range of generative models into Adobe’s flagship products.
- Design and build ML workflows for enterprise‑scale model customization, serving, and ecosystem integration.
- Collaborate with Adobe Research and other model developer teams with a focus on model inference strategies and productization of those models.
- Build and optimize GPU‑accelerated pipelines for both customized model training and inference—prioritizing performance, scalability, and reliability.
- Foster a culture of innovation, technical excellence, and continuous improvement across the organization.
- MS or PhD in Computer Science, Machine Learning, or a related field—or equivalent industry experience.
- 10+ years of experience in machine learning, including production‑scale deployments.
- 3+ years of experience leading large‑scale, GPU‑intensive GenAI systems (training, inference, and optimization).
- Experience with GenAI frameworks and tools such as PyTorch, CUDA, Triton, Tensor
RT, Nvidia Dynamo, and Python. - Good understanding of generative model architectures, including diffusion models, transformers, and GANs.
- Good communication and leadership skills, with a track record of driving alignment in matrixed organizations.
- Experience with model serving, inference, orchestration, and GPU resource management in large‑scale environments.
- Hands‑on expertise in Kubernetes, distributed systems, and MLOps platforms.
Our compensation reflects the cost of labor across several U.S. geographic markets, and we pay differently based on those defined markets. The U.S. pay range for this position is $190,200 – $345,650 annually. Pay within this range varies by work location and may also depend on job‑related knowledge, skills, and experience. In California, the pay range for this position is $238,700 – $345,650.
In Washington, the pay range for this position is $223,500 – $323,700.
Adobe is proud to be an Equal Employment Opportunity employer. We do not discriminate based on gender, race or color, ethnicity or national origin, age, disability, religion, sexual orientation, gender identity or expression, veteran status, or any other protected characteristic.
Adobe aims to make our careers website and recruiting process accessible to any and all users. If you have a disability or special need that requires accommodation to navigate our website or complete the application process, please contact or call .
#J-18808-Ljbffr(If this job is in fact in your jurisdiction, then you may be using a Proxy or VPN to access this site, and to progress further, you should change your connectivity to another mobile device or PC).